Probably a lot, but how much of it will be useful or usable is an
entirely different question.
> Also, a thought is a questionaire online saying "what would you like to
> see?" "what do you think should be changed?" etc
That makes more sense. A well considered survey, asking the right
questions and running for a few weeks, with announcements and reminders
about it in all the channels you mentioned, would be far more useful,
and much easier to process.
There's no need to restrict the announcement to Gentoo channels either,
the likes of Distrowatch and LWN could be used too.
